Jana Kramer bio
Jana Kramer, an actor and singer-songwriter who specializes in country-pop music as well as songwriting, gained fame in the world of television when she was Alex during the final three seasons on One Tree Hill. The show showcased her first releases as country music, propelling her 2012 debut album to the Billboard 200 to the Top 20. Thirty One (2015), the follow-up album in 2015, was also among into the Top Ten. In the last decade, she was a guest as a contestant on Dancing with the Stars as well in TV movies and various TV programs. She also released some singles which weren't albums. Voices, a self-doubting album released in 2021. Jana Rae Kramer was born and was raised within Rochester Hills Michigan. She grew up listening to country music, and eventually went on to explore a career in recording. However, she first made an acting debut when she was young teenager in 2002's independent horror film Dead/Undead. Guest spots on shows such as All My Children and CSI: NY followed over the following years, until she landed the part as Noelle Davenport on NBC's Friday Night Lights in the course of the show's second season 2007-2008. Kramer later appeared on television in the role of Portia ranson on 90210 from 2008 to 2009 and Brooke Manning in Entourage in the year 2009. She was added to the cast of CW One Tree Hill in 2009 in the role of Alex Dupre, and she continued to appear until the final episode in 2012, about halfway into. Jana Kramer Kramer began her career with One Tree Hill in 2011. The actress signed a contract with Elektra Records during this time and released the country-rock song "I Won't Go Down" during the show's episode. This track appeared later on the debut full-length album of Jana Kramer in mid 2012. The track reached in the Top Five on the Billboard Top Country Albums Chart. Focusing on her music career thereafter without retiring from acting she appeared in films like Heart of the Country 2013 and Country Crush 2016 that would be popular with her fan base. In October of 2015, Kramer came out with thirty One from Warner Music Nashville. I Got the Boy - an album that was a Top Five Country hit - and Steven Tyler, Aerosmith's lead vocalist, singing a duet on the album reach the top ten spot on the Billboard 200. The month of September 2016 saw her stint in the 23rd season of Dancing with the Stars lasted two months and ended in a fourth place finish. That year she also had an adult-oriented hit song featuring the song "Feels Like" Christmas featuring Straight No Chaser.
